BLURB:


In Praetoria, the elite do not have any special talents. Then why is it the only imperial princess is having vision-like nightmares? These dreams foretell the destruction of her world and the death of her family, and every day they gain strength in their horror.

The return of a particular imperial rook changes the tone of her dreams, providing her with much needed relief. But this too is perplexing, for he is a rook and she an elite. The law strictly forbids a union between the two.

Yet four little female moiohs scheme to bring them together, providing the path to secure their future, a future threatened by traitors who would use the princess as a way to steal her father's throne.

Excerpt:

Keira opens her eyes slowly, fearfully, her heart hammering in her chest as she steels herself for the worst. To her relief she finds herself alone in a dimly lit room. The scent of Tyleeose flowers lightly fragrances the air and she can sense nothing dangerous near her. Carefully she studies her surroundings and struggles to get her bearings. To her right is a dark door leading to only the High One knows where, and to her left is a softly illuminated archway heading to another chamber from which sounds of moiohish voices can be heard.

After a few moments of silent debate her curiosity gets the best of her and she walks tentatively toward the sound. Before long her hand grazes the smooth stone wall of the opening and, after taking a deep fortifying breath, she cautiously peeks around its edge. Her eyes are drawn to three tiny female figures sitting in a semi-circle in the centre of the room, their innocent faces illuminated by a small incandescent orb set on a shelf behind the moioh facing her.

As one they turn to look at her, and she is struck by their uncommon resemblance to each other. The colour of their eyes and hair are the only things that distinguish one from the other. Even their expressions are identical as they note her entrance and smile radiantly at her. In sweet unison, they sing out, “Mama is here, Mama is here!”

Startled, she stares at them dumbfounded, her mouth dry and eyes wide in surprise and uncertainty. The moioh facing Kiera, her green eyes glowing with an inner light, raises her hand and beckons Kiera forward, her melodious voice entreating, “Come closer, Mama. Little sister needs you.” Her companions on either side nod in agreement.

She notices a bassinet on the floor between them and feels compelled to step closer. She looks down and sees nestled between soft blankets of crimson and gold a beautiful, fragile looking bayba. Her expression softens and her heart melt as the little one opens her tiny mouth in a huge yawn. She looks up at Kiera with sleepy little hazel eyes and, with an expression of utter contentment, she reaches out as if asking Kiera to hold her. She eagerly steps forward to obey.

Just as she is about to pick the precious bayba up, two strong arms encircle her waist. Shocked, she twists her torso and head, bracing her hands on her unknown assailant’s arms. Anxiously, she looks up into the greenest eyes she has ever seen. Her mouth opens and closes as her mind races for the proper reprimand for his unseemly actions. Just as she is about to say something to put him in his place, she recognizes him.


My Review:

Harbinger is an intense and captivating read that gradually reveals what is happening, keeping you engaged as you try to understand the unfolding events. I give high praise to the author for the tremendous effort that must have gone into writing a story like Harbinger.

The people of Harbinger live under a caste system. The Elite typically possess no magic; only the Praetoria have magical abilities. Keira, the imperial princess, experiences visions and dreams about the destruction of her world and the demise of her family. She finds herself trapped in her dream world for days while her family keeps vigil over her.

The world-building in Harbinger is astonishing. I truly love the world that has been created for Harbinger, as it is remarkable. I can only imagine the amount of work involved in crafting the world of Harbinger and how long it must have taken to write such a story.

I look forward to the next installment in the Praetoria Chronicles to discover what happens next.
